> Experiments have shown that microwaving plastic baby food containers available on the shelves of U.S. stores can release huge numbers of plastic particles — in some cases, more than 2 billion nanoplastics and 4 million microplastics for every square centimeter of container. > After two days, just 23% of kidney cells exposed to the highest concentrations had managed to survive — a much higher mortality rate than tha…

A cell culture would die if the water was slightly saltier than regular media. Or the temperature was a few degrees higher, or the gas concentration was off by a few percent, or the shape of the container is weird, or etc. etc.

You need a much more rigorous study to determine toxicity to a full-size living organism. Much more costly and much less likely to get funding...

Plastic is made of oils. Oils degrade and/or dissolve with heat.

Plastic is not an oil, not to mention you can make plastic from air and nothing else (other than energy). (You can make plastic from CO2 and Water.)

Plastics are polymers, oils are not. Oils have specific chain lengths, polymers have no specific length. Both are hydrocarbons, but almost everything we interact with is, so that's not saying much.

Saying something degrades with heat means very little - everything degrades with heat. The question is how much heat.
